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"is experiencing a shift"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a change or transition occurring in a situation, condition, or perspective. Example: "The company is experiencing a shift in its marketing strategy to adapt to new consumer trends."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"is experiencing a shift" when describing a noticeable change or transition affecting a particular subject or area. Ensure the context clearly indicates what is changing and the nature of the shift.
Common error
While "is experiencing a shift" is acceptable, overuse can make your writing sound repetitive. Vary your language by using synonyms like "is undergoing a transition" or "is evolving" dep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
is undergoing a transition
Uses "undergoing" instead of "experiencing" and "transition" instead of "shift", implying a process of change.
is in the midst of a transformation
Replaces "shift" with "transformation", suggesting a more profound or fundamental change.
is seeing a change
Simplifies the phrase to emphasize observation of change rather than active experience.
is evolving
Implies a gradual and continuous development or change.
is developing
Suggests a process of growth and maturation, often used for emerging trends.
is trending towards
Focuses on the direction of change rather than the experience of it.
is moving towards
Indicates movement in a specific direction, similar to "trending towards".
is witnessing a transition
Highlights the act of observing a change rather than being directly affected by it.
is subject to change
Indicates that the subject is liable or likely to change, focusing on potential rather than current experience.
is transforming
Implies a significant and fundamental change in form or character.
FAQs
What does "is experiencing a shift" mean?
The phrase "is experiencing a shift" means that something is undergoing a change or transition. It indicates that the subject is moving from one state, condition, or perspective to another.
What can I say instead of "is experiencing a shift"?
You can use alternatives like "is undergoing a transition", "is seeing a change", or "is evolving" depending on the context.
Is "is experiencing a shift" formal or informal?
The phrase "is experiencing a shift" is generally considered neutral and can be used in both formal and informal contexts. However, for very formal writing, consider alternatives like "is undergoing a transformation" for added emphasis.
How do I use "is experiencing a shift" in a sentence?
You can use "is experiencing a shift" to describe changes in various contexts. For example: "The e-commerce industry "is experiencing a shift" toward subscription-based consumables."
